![Building Photo - 7626 N Marshfield Ave Rental](https://images1.forrent.com/i2/L-nREOoViHvvbYPZ4SYq0PM6Jp8Bgjxk-sO7qiKL7C0/117/image.jpg?p=1)
Filter Your Search
All Filters
Rent Range
-Pet-Friendly Apartments for Rent in Evanston, IL
649 Apartments Available
Sort
- Default
- Lowest Price
- Highest Price
- Newest Listings
Filter Your Search
- Specials
- Specials
7600 N Sheridan Rd, Chicago, IL 60626
7600 N Sheridan Rd, Chicago, IL 60626
Studio - 1 Bed $1,315 - $1,550
#1310 - The Villages of Eastlake
1310-1320 W Birchwood Ave, Chicago, IL 60626
2 - 3 Beds $2,050 - $2,750